Apollo 8: the mission that changed everything

wikipedia

Six months before Neil Armstrong set foot on the Moon, the U.S. Space Program's mission Apollo 8 succeeded in a manned space craft orbit of the moon for the first time. The mission was so risky even the NASA Flight director believed the astronauts only had a 50% chance of returning safely to earth. On The Point, Mindy Todd interviews Martin Sandler about his book Apollo 8- The Mission that Changed Everything.
